このスレッドは解決済です(未解決に戻す場合はこちら)
<<戻る

yumでdagのエラー このメッセージに返信する
日時: 2006/11/07 15:40
名前: K
URL:
運用済みのCentOS4で yum -y update をすると

[root@yukiserve yum]# yum -y update
Setting up Update Process
Setting up repositories
//var/cache/yum/dag/repomd.xml:1: parser error : Document is empty

^
//var/cache/yum/dag/repomd.xml:1: parser error : Start tag expected, '<' not found

^
dag 100% |=========================| 0 B 00:00
http://apt.sw.be/redhat/el4/en/i386/dag/repodata/repomd.xml: [Errno -1] Error importing repomd.xml for dag: Error: could not parse file //var/cache/yum/dag/repomd.xml
Trying other mirror.
Cannot open/read repomd.xml file for repository: dag
failure: repodata/repomd.xml from dag: [Errno 256] No more mirrors to try.
Error: failure: repodata/repomd.xml from dag: [Errno 256] No more mirrors to try.

とエラーが出てしまいました。
そこであちこちで調べて yum -y --disablerepo=dag update として急場をしのいだのですが、dagというものが壊れているという認識でいいのでしょうか?
復旧させるにはどうしたらいいのでしょうか?

よろしくお願いいたします。
記事編集 編集
Re: yumでdagのエラー このメッセージに返信する
日時: 2006/11/07 16:34
名前: 初心者
URL:
同じの問題が発生してしまいました。

元々「dag.repo」に記入しているbaseurlの方が何かの問題が発生していたらしいでした。
とりあえず、以下のようにミラーサイドのURLを入れ替えて、無事に動作できるように
なりました。

vi /etc/yum.repos.d/dag.repo
#baseurl=http://apt.sw.be/redhat/el$releasever/en/$basearch/dag
baseurl=http://mirror.cpsc.ucalgary.ca/mirror/dag/redhat/el4/en/i386/dag
記事編集 編集
Re: yumでdagのエラー このメッセージに返信する
日時: 2006/11/22 11:27
名前: K
URL:
現在は解決しているようです。
ありがとうございました。
記事編集 編集
件名※必須
名前※必須
URL
任意のパスワード (投稿後のコメント修正・削除時に使用)
画像認証※必須 投稿キー(画像で表示されている数字を入力)
コメント※必須

※質問を投稿後に自己解決された場合は、原因と行った対処を具体的に書き込み下さるよう、よろしくお願いします。

- WEB PATIO -